Obituary for Dr. Raymond J. Morandi Sr.

Dr. Raymond J.  Morandi Sr.
Dr. Raymond J. Morandi, Sr., Korean War Army Veteran, beloved husband of 43 years to Janice, nee Blough. Loving father of Kristin (David) Pomonis, Carla (Todd) Walters and Raymond II (Megan) Morandi. Cherished grampy of Madisyn, Paige and Nicholas Pomonis; Blake, Kylie and Kayla Walters; Lucca and Taylan Morandi. Devoted son of the late Raymond Peter and Bernice Morandi. Dearest brother of Robert (Syble) Morandi, Carol (Donald) Parker, late Elaine (late Leo) Ostrowski and the late LaVerne (late William) Prystasz. Fond son-in-law of Mary and the late Harold Blough. Dear uncle of many nieces and nephews.

Raymond was a Veterinarian, he founded Orland Park Equine Hospital in 1966.
